What is dYdX DEX?

dYdX DEX is a decentralized exchange focusing on derivatives, perpetual contracts, and margin trading. It provides non‑custodial trading (you hold your assets in your wallet) and has moved much of its infrastructure off‑chain or to Layer 2 (StarkWare) to reduce gas fees and increase performance. :contentReference[oaicite:0]{index=0}

One of its recent evolutions is the move toward the dYdX Chain (v4), built with Cosmos SDK / Tendermint / CometBFT consensus, aiming to deliver a fully decentralized order book, high throughput, lower latency, and enhanced governance. :contentReference[oaicite:1]{index=1}

2FA Reset / Account Recovery

dYdX is non‑custodial: your wallet is the authentication method. Traditional 2FA (TOTP, SMS) is generally not part of the core. If you used a UI or third‑party overlay that added 2FA, follow their instructions or support. Always make sure you securely store your wallet seed phrase / recovery phrase.

FAQ: dYdX DEX — Common User Questions

Q: Why is dYdX not working / site unresponsive?
A: Possible reasons: front‑end issues or maintenance, network / wallet connectivity problems, incorrect domain (avoid phishing sites), browser cache or extension conflicts.
Q: What should I do if I’m unable to login to dYdX DEX?
A: Ensure your wallet is unlocked and supports the signature method in use; check that you are using a supported browser; clear cache; ensure using the official dYdX interface URL; consider switching wallet or device.
Q: How can I reset 2FA / recover account on dYdX?
A: Since dYdX uses wallet‑based authentication, you don’t reset “2FA” in the traditional way. If a third‑party UI provided 2FA, follow its recovery procedure. Most importantly, retain access to your wallet’s secret key or mnemonic phrase.
Q: Why do I see “Error Connecting dYdX” or “Can’t verify dYdX”?
A: Usually due to wallet / RPC / signature mismatch, issues with browser extensions, or outdated wallet software. Try reconnecting, switching RPC/network, using a different wallet or browser.
Q: Why is my deposit not showing / stuck?
A: Check the transaction hash in the blockchain explorer; ensure correct wallet/account. Wait for confirmations depending on “Instant” vs “Standard” deposit type. Also check if any relayer or bridge delays are affecting the deposit. :contentReference[oaicite:19]{index=19}
Q: Why was my trade declined or failed on dYdX?
A: Declines often arise from strict slippage or limit settings, insufficient collateral or margin, or stale oracle prices. Adjust settings or use a smaller trade size; monitor oracle status or platform announcements.
